About 151 PET

Reverse dateless plates place the numbers before the original local index letters, so the registration carries local authority provenance without a year marker. The ET index mark traces back to Rotherham, now associated with South Yorkshire. This reverse sequence was issued from the 1950s onwards as earlier dateless runs became exhausted. At 6 characters, 151 PET is a standard-length registration for this era.
